Address 0 PPC

PHEe8dEHo439eJUZPyHSmbFUMvHucdySPC

Confirmed

Total Received50.572923 PPC
Total Sent50.572923 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PHEe8dEHo439eJUZPyHSmbFUMvHucdySPC50.572923 PPC
Fee: 0.01 PPC
651184 Confirmations50.562923 PPC
PHEe8dEHo439eJUZPyHSmbFUMvHucdySPC50.572923 PPC
PL8LKHxjvHKGwwreALWwFpkyL8Yr4dkwLe3.270378 PPC
Fee: 0.01 PPC
651185 Confirmations53.843301 PPC